Fire impacts on Earth across space and time: a discussion-driven conference

Earth is the only known planet with fire activity – everywhere else, there is not enough oxygen for this process to occur. Since fire appeared on Earth many millions of years ago, it has played a key role in the development of plant adaptation and the distribution of ecosystems.
